Default Malibu 6.0 turbo build

Doing a 78 Malibu 6.0 turbo build I pick up the car for $400 then I found a trailer for $300, now I'm picking up the 2001 6.0 for $650, this is a frame of build so it's gonna be a while but by winter it will back on the frame and the 10point cage will be in, my plans are blow thru carb with a s475 stock heads ported with new springs, motor will be freshened with barrings, rings,arp bolts, bigger cam, tranny and rearend I'm still undecided about. I will put up some pics when I can any thoughts and ideas will be appreciated.
